Learner permit

Getting a learner permit is the first step to getting your driver's license. This temporary permit permits you to test drive with a licensed adult who supervises you. The permit is also subject to limitations, like curfews for night driving, passenger limits or the prohibition of texting. You can also take the driver's education course to increase your knowledge and experience prior to taking your road exam.



You will need to fill out an form MV-44 and provide proof of your age and identity to get your learner's license. You will also need to pass a vision test and pay the applicable fee. It is a good idea to save time by having all these documents ready prior to your visit to the DMV office. Also, ensure you have a copy of your New York State Driver's Manual. This will help you prepare for your written exam and identify any questions that may be difficult to understand.

You can find practice tests online or in study guide books that are available at bookstores. You can also sign up for a pre-licensing class, which will provide instruction in the classroom as well as hands-on driving experience.

To pass the test in writing, you will need to complete 14 out of 20 questions correctly. The test includes four road sign identification questions Be sure to study these thoroughly. You should be able to recognize the common kinds of signs and roads including yield warnings, pedestrian crossings and speed limit signs.

If you fail the test, you could have to take it again in two weeks or attend an Driver's Ed class. You will then be required to get some supervision for driving experience and meet other requirements for driving before you can take your road test (or "driving test"). Driver's license

A driver's license is a form of identification issued by a state's department for motor vehicles that permits the driver to operate vehicles on public roads. It typically contains the driver's name and date of birth, current address and photo. It could also contain other information, such as endorsements or restrictions. Depending on the country it could also include the bearer's social security numbers or other personal identifiers. To get a driver's license you must meet eligibility criteria, study traffic laws and drive under supervision. Then you will be required to pass written and road tests. Drivers may also have to submit medical records in the event of being diagnosed with certain health conditions that hinder safe driving.

Registration of vehicles

The registration of your car is a crucial step to ensure the safety of you and other motorists. It identifies a vehicle the owner and allows law enforcement officers to track who is driving on public roads. Each state has its own registration process that is managed by the Department of Motor Vehicles or transportation agency. You will generally need to show evidence of ownership or proof of identity in order to register your car.

In the United States most cars are required to be registered before they are allowed to drive on roads that are public. No matter if you're a permanent resident or a newcomer to the state it's essential to get your car registered to avoid penalties, fines and other fines. If you purchase a new or used car from a dealer, they usually take care of the title and registration for you. If you purchase the vehicle from a private dealer, you'll need to prepare your own paperwork and complete the registration process yourself. You should also keep copies of the paperwork, in case you ever need the documents in the future.

Car Insurance

When looking for car insurance, it is important to get multiple quotes and compare them carefully. The rates, coverage limits, and discounts offered by different companies must be considered carefully. It is important to have the vehicle identification number and current mileage in hand to help in assessing the risk.

Typically, you will need to provide proof of insurance before the state is able to reinstate your license. Some companies will only cover cars registered to policyholders. It is important to remember that certain cars are more expensive to insure than other types of vehicles. Some policies exclude drivers with a poor driving record.

Maintaining a clean record on your driving is important to get the best rate. Reduce the amount of time you are driving to lower your costs. You can save money by combining car and home insurance with the same company. Some companies offer discounts and perks such as anti-theft devices. You may be able to lower your premiums when you have a high credit score and are married.
